Find the length of the diagonal of a square with side length 5 square root of 5

Respuesta :

Ursus Ursus
  • 29-02-2020

Answer:

Diagonal length =[tex]5\sqrt{10}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Length of the diagonal of a square = [tex]\sqrt{2} *a[/tex]

where, ' [tex]a[/tex]' is the side of the square

Side length of the square ([tex]a[/tex])= [tex]5\sqrt{5}[/tex]

Length of the diagonal=

                                       =[tex]\sqrt{2} *5\sqrt{5} \\\\5\sqrt{10}[/tex]

The square with give side length of [tex]5\sqrt{5}[/tex], have a diagonal length of [tex]5\sqrt{10}[/tex]
